Abstract

Hypothermia is a major cause of morbidity and mortality in newborns at developing countries. The World Health Organizations (WHO) has recommens  to maintain heat in newborns care, however hypothermia continues become a normal neonatal condition, which is unidentified, not documented and limited treatment. The purpose of this study was to determine the relationship between IMD and body temperature of newborns in 2019 BPM Fauziah Hatta Palembang. The method uses in this study was to uses descriptive analytical design, collecting samples using accidental sampling totaling 50 people respondent, data was collected by measuring temperature directly after birth and 1 hour after birth using a digital thermometer and recorded in the observation sheet. The results showed a ρ-value of 0,000 <ɑ (0,05) which means there is a significant relationship between the Initiation of Early Breastfeeding Against the Body Temperature of a Newborn. It is expected that the IMD method is implemented by health staffs, particularly midwives in order to assist the improvment of body temperature within the normal of newborns.
